Genshin Impacthas already revealed three new characters who are scheduled to arrive in Version 3.0. Players will have the option to acquire those limited characters during their run on a limited banner.

Each timeGenshin Impactplayers pull on a banner, it triggers a special wishing animation revealing their new items. A post on the popularGenshin ImpactLeaks subreddit reveals the wishing animations for three upcoming characters: Tighnari, Collei, and Dori.

All of them are expected to arrive in the upcomingGenshin ImpactVersion 3.0, however, it’s highly unlikely that they will be placed on the same banner. Players expect Tighnari to appear the first banner since he’s the only new five-star character. Collei is also expected to be a part of the same banner considering that previous leaks revealed that players will receive her for free in the new major update. The game usually grants one free four-star character whenever a new major region arrives to the game.

A couple of fans were confused by the fact that the banner in the video features Arataki Itto, but this is probably just a placeholder for the limited character banner in the ongoing 3.0 beta. Tignari’s name is apparently based on a popular Arab scientist by the name Al-Tighnari which seems plausible since Sumeru’s design takes a lot of inspiration from Southeast Asia and the Middle East. Previous constellation leaks have revealed thatTighnari will most likely be a new DPS characterwith strong sub-DPS capabilities.

However, these leaks should still be taken with a grain of salt considering that he will rely on thenew Dendro elemental reactionsand HoYoverse is yet to reveal the specific numbers for the new element. The recentGenshin ImpactDendro preview led many players to believe that it has the potential to become the strongest element inGenshin Impactdue to its synergy with almost any other element in the game.

The two other characters, Collei and Dori, have a lower four-star rarity and both of them are expected to be new supports. A big part of the community claims that, despite her lower rarity, Collei could still be more useful than Tighnari since she seems to have a much better Dendro application. With the introduction of the new Dendro element, players expect the main character to receive anew set of Dendro abilities.
